Rameau's Nephew

Diderot's light is illuminating, and we'll all come away smiling!

About

In an unusual theatre, full of charm and history, Diderot engages in a sparkling, funny and explosive conversation.

«This dialogue explodes like a bomb in the middle of French literature».» said Goethe.

In two hundred years, it hasn't aged a day!
